## Recovery: Admin Table Bulk Edits (Lattice Panel)

Plugin authors: if a bulk edit locks your admin account out of the Lattice Panel, stop all writes. Export the affected rows, revert via the audit log, then re-authenticate through the recovery console. The console rejects stale sessions. Enter the recovery passphrase shown below.

unlock words, yawig-kagef: gordor-holvan-ulaael-pramir-ulaiel-tamdor

## Authentication

The Garthside occupancy feed publishes per-level parking counts from the Millbrane garages every 30 seconds. All requests to the internal ingest endpoint require a static key passed in the `X-Garthside-Key` header over TLS; there is no OAuth flow. Keys are scoped read-only and rotated quarterly by the Pellworth ops group. For review purposes, the current staging key is provided below.

gateway credential: kto23_LX9A4ys6i4nzHtpOLNLodKK

Subject: Interview room access

Hi all,

A reminder from the front desk: candidate interviews should be held in the Larkspur Room on level 2, which is kept locked between sessions. Please book it through the room planner at least a day ahead and meet your candidate in reception. When you arrive at the door, unlock it with the code shown below.

door code, kawip-bagap: bdg-HQEWH-4

## Step 2: Configure Shrinkly

Before deploying the Shrinkly batch-resize CLI, reviewers should confirm the worker concurrency and output bucket in `.env.shrinkly` match the capacity plan. Incorrect concurrency has previously saturated the asset store. Verify `SHRINKLY_WORKERS=8` and `SHRINKLY_BUCKET=resized-assets`, then on the following line add the storage access credential.

env line for yahip-tafog: RELAY_SECRET3=4ca